Thamel

Thamel buzzes with energy as Kathmandu's cultural heart and backpacker haven. Narrow cobblestone alleys overflow with shops selling traditional crafts, trekking gear, and souvenirs. Prayer flags flutter between buildings housing budget guesthouses and rooftop restaurants. Garden of Dreams provides a peaceful escape from the neighborhood's lively atmosphere. Visitors can explore ancient temples, enjoy live music venues, or bargain at Asan Bazaar. The pedestrian-friendly maze offers affordable dining from street food to international cuisine.

Boudhha

Circle Boudhanath Stupa with locals and pilgrims in this sacred Buddhist district of Kathmandu. Prayer flags flutter above as you explore monasteries filled with chanting monks and fragrant incense. Tibetan influence shapes this spiritual neighborhood's unique character. Wander through vibrant markets selling prayer wheels, thangka paintings, and traditional handicrafts. The area's walkable streets lead to hidden temples and authentic Tibetan restaurants. Rooftop terraces offer peaceful views of the magnificent UNESCO World Heritage stupa that dominates the skyline.

Gaushala

The Gaushala neighborhood in Kathmandu centers around the sacred Pashupatinath Temple complex, Nepal's holiest Hindu site. Golden pagoda roofs rise above intricate wood carvings while funeral pyres burn along the Bagmati River. Saffron-robed sadhus meditate among smaller shrines as pilgrims perform traditional rituals. This deeply authentic religious area maintains centuries-old traditions with minimal tourism infrastructure. Simple vegetarian restaurants and budget guesthouses cater primarily to spiritual visitors. Most activity follows temple rhythms, beginning before dawn and quieting after sunset when temple bells and chanting give way to evening tranquility.

  • Pashupatinath Temple: This sacred Hindu temple, dedicated to Lord Shiva, is a UNESCO World Heritage Site. It features stunning architecture and vibrant rituals, especially during the evening aarti ceremony, where devotees gather for a spiritual experience along the Bagmati River.
  • Jaisi Deval Temple: Nestled in the heart of Kathmandu, this historical temple showcases intricate carvings and sculptures. It is a serene spot for reflection, offering insight into the local culture and ancient architectural styles.
  • Boudhanath: One of the largest stupas in Nepal, Boudhanath is a major pilgrimage site for Buddhists. Its massive mandala and vibrant surrounding shops create a unique atmosphere, perfect for soaking in the spiritual energy and local life.

Best time to go to Kathmandu

The best time to visit Kathmandu can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Kathmandu falls in June, when vis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ly cloudy with frequent rain. The coolest average temperature in Kathmandu falls in January, visitor numbers are average and weather is sunny with no rain.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January48.9°F (9.4°C)No RainSunnyAverageSlightly Low
February53.1°F (11.7°C)No RainSunnyAverageAverage
March61.2°F (16.2°C)No RainSunnySlightly HighSlightly Low
April67.3°F (19.6°C)Light RainSunnyAverageAverage
May69.1°F (20.6°C)Frequent RainMostly SunnySlightly LowSlightly High
June71.6°F (22.0°C)Frequent R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
July70.3°F (21.3°C)Frequent RainMostly CloudySlightly HighAverage
August69.8°F (21.0°C)Frequent R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
September68.0°F (20.0°C)Frequent R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ly Low
October63.0°F (17.2°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owAverage
November56.5°F (13.6°C)No RainSunnySlightly LowSlightly High
December51.3°F (10.7°C)No RainSunnyAverageSlightly High
